#4155DA Hex color

#4155DA

The hexadecimal color code #4155DA corresponds to the code RGB( 65, 85, 218 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,25 level), green (at 0,33 level) and blue (at 0,85 level). Its brightness is 55% and its saturation is 67%. It is composed of red at 17%, green at 23% and blue at 59%.
